Postdoctoral Researcher (m/f/d) Oral Drug Delivery

The BioMed X Institute in Heidelberg, Germany, is establishing a new, fully funded research group in the field of:

Translocation of Complex Macromolecules Across the Intestinal Epithelial Barrier

If you hold a PhD or Master’s degree and have an outstanding track record or strong interest in the field of drug delivery, we invite you to apply with a project proposal for this position in our new research group (1 group leader, 2 postdoctoral researchers, 2 research assistants).

Each BioMed X project team is sponsored by an industry partner. The sponsor of this call for application is Janssen.

Complex macromolecules, including biologics such as monoclonal antibodies, have transformed the treatment of immune-related diseases, but they need to be delivered by injection, which limits their use relative to oral delivery. Although there are several techniques available to shield these macromolecules from the harsh conditions of the gastrointestinal tract, little progress has been made to translocate complex macromolecules across the intestinal epithelial barrier into systemic circulation.

The aim of this project is to discover novel transport mechanisms in the human intestinal tract which could be utilized for oral systemic delivery of diverse therapeutic modalities (e.g. peptides, oligonucleotides, and antibodies). The resulting delivery platform should enable the development of a new generation of oral immunotherapies for the benefit of patients. The key objectives include:

To model and explore the induction mechanisms of transcytosis pathways in the human intestinal epithelium;

To systematically screen for the most efficient chemical or biological moieties that induce transcytosis of complex biomolecules across the intestinal epithelium;

To validate the efficiency of the resulting platform with a selection of diverse therapeutic modalities.

Proposals building on very original ideas supported by first experimental findings are particularly encouraged.

Candidates for postdoctoral positions are expected to have completed a PhD or equivalent within the last four years and a certain degree of specialization in one or more relevant cutting-edge technologies.
